I've got quite a big pheonix canariensis here in Norfolk, bought it as a large specimen several years ago and its doing very well. Tied the crown the first couple of winters. Lost smaller ones in the past.

I have one that has lasted two winters so far. Put fleece bunched up in the centre, tied up fronds and covered with a fleece bag. Looks fine now! In the West Midlands.

I haven't had much luck with them. I am inland Kent and it's always a few degrees colder than the area I work in London...at least 2 or 3c colder. However, I have three small ones in the garden...been planted out two years. Last winter I wrapped them in fleece, then a fleece bag over...all made it... outta fronds a mess but still got through. But I would class them as not hardy around here
